Colors of Italy + CD
If you like the music of Frank Voltz, you will absolutely love this collection from William Mahan of some of the most beautiful melodies ever. Truly inspired, these compositions can be used for any type of situation: for yourself, for healing music, for background music, for recitals. The music is not difficult, but the LH does require some crossing over and under. True to the Italian flavor, some of the melodies incorporate triplet and mordent ornamentation. You'll need a full size lever harp or pedal harp to play these tunes. There are a few lever changes, but with just a little practice they will go smoothly. Gentle and flowing, you'll find a lyric right hand melody supported by lush chords. Some fingerings are included. The music has been edited by Mary Radspinner. Please listen to the samples and take a look at the visual examples from some of the pages. All music either in C or G. The final tune, All the Colors of Rome, is a 5-minute plus performance piece that is gorgeous. Mary Radspinner plays through all the titles on the CD, using a Dusty Strings Bubinga 36S.
Titles:
Bellagio Blue, Warm Sienna, Sicilian Scarlet, Tuscan Gold, Venetian Red, Naples Yellow, Vatican Violet, All the Colors of Rome.
